Output c8584838b0654defeeb850152601d1c93f053dad6471419d8d1aa9a8ebffc200:22

value
108406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b51fe748a21b655af540d87fea5452c067333fd OP_EQUAL
address
376g1uHosvzKWnoGCAQsXRhAq9WsD26PrB
transaction
c8584838b0654defeeb850152601d1c93f053dad6471419d8d1aa9a8ebffc200
spent
true